Output 66bad6d3ebf8b87c171418a097ed63c2d900801e161cb76d6e02c7725d21ece7:2

value
117010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4704e8d9415046209446eb66ae7637c676f3cb OP_EQUAL
address
3QsWdmUiBoNXGFtFgQZLRfQLG4Z9jfEjRe
transaction
66bad6d3ebf8b87c171418a097ed63c2d900801e161cb76d6e02c7725d21ece7
confirmations
348692
spent
true